Paramount Set to Drop HD DVD as Well?

This might be the straw that broke HD DVD's back if it turns out to be true.

According to a story from London's Financial Times, Paramount is looking at abandoning the HD DVD format it signed on with less than a year ago. The story states that there is a clause in Paramount's contract with HD DVD that would allow the studio to get out of its contract if Warner Bros. did in fact switch over to Blu-Ray exclusively. Since that scenario is now a reality, it appears that Paramount may indeed use that clause and switch over exclusively to the Blu-Ray format. It is unclear if Dreamworks Animation, which signed its deal with HD DVD at the same time as Paramount, has the same clause in its contract.

If this scenario does unfold as reported, that would leave only Universal Studios as the only major studio supporting the HD DVD format. Universal declined comment for the Financial Times story.
